- [ ] **Step 7: Breaker override escrow.** After sealing the signing keys for the Tallgrove upstream API circuit breaker, confirm the support team can force the breaker open during a full outage. The override bundle lives in the sealed escrow drawer and is useless without its unlock phrase. Two ceremony witnesses must initial this step before proceeding. The escrow bundle is decrypted with the recovery passphrase that follows.

vault phrase of kahip-kahop = holath-quenmir

The Squallwire weather-alert fan-out is delivering plugin payloads with elevated latency. Alerts accepted by the ingest tier are queued normally, but dispatch to third-party plugin endpoints may lag by up to eight minutes. No alerts are being dropped; retries follow the standard backoff schedule documented in the Squallwire plugin guide. Plugin authors should not resubmit acknowledgements during this window. For delivery-log questions or to report discrepancies, contact the fan-out operations desk at the address below.

pager mailbox: silael.sorwyn.tamius@zemvarsys.corp

### Runbook: Report export timezone mismatches (Glimmerfield)

If a customer reports that exported totals differ from the dashboard, check whether their report schedule predates the March cutover — older schedules still render in server-local time rather than the account timezone. Re-saving the schedule fixes it. Before escalating, confirm the export worker is running with the expected timezone settings shown below.

config for kadup-kajog:
[raldor]
host = raldor.tolvaqworks.internal
user = raldor_svc
database = raldor_prod

## Deploying the Gatewick Proctor Queue

Deploys are pretty painless: push to main, wait for the pipeline, then watch the queue drain dashboard for five minutes. If candidates pile up mid-exam, roll back first and ask questions later — the queue replays safely. Everything the workers care about lives in one config block, shown here for reference.

settings of bafof-yagef:
JOROX_PIN=8740
JOROX_TENANT=pelox
JOROX_METRICS_HOST=metrics.jorox.qorvelworks.internal
JOROX_SEAL=seal_c78f63c1
JOROX_STANDBY_TEAM=norax